A dramatization of the behind-the-scenes story of the IMF negotiations that took place during the financial crisis in 1997, through three parallel stories.

Default Reviews
Hollywood Reporter
Clarence Tsui
An engaging multi-strand story about a nation in turmoil.
Variety
Maggie Lee
Manages to make currency crashes and the Asian Financial Crisis a juicy subject onscreen.
Los Angeles Times
Noel Murray
"Default" successfully turns a global financial crisis into a movie that's at once engaging and educational.
Cinema Escapist
Richard Yu
Default is still a relatively good introduction to an oft-forgotten (at least in the West) financial crisis.
